I was recently contacted by Old Factory Candle to see if I would like to try out their Gift Set. I jumped at the chance since I obsessed with candles and love that they are soy so burn much cleaner than the standard wax candle. These candles are currently sold exclusively on Amazon and come in many different scents. Their candles are hand-poured in the USA with natural soy wax, self-trimming cotton candle wicks, and premium fragrance oils. The Old Factory Candle Gift Sets each contain 3 different scented candles. Each candle burns clean and even for 20 hours. The subtle jar design makes it the perfect complement for any decor, and any room of the house – kitchen, bedroom, bathroom, family room, great room, and basement.  Each gift set is themed around a group of related fragrances.
